- The distance between Bondoukou, Ivory Coast and Kawthaung, Myanmar is approximately 11,083 km or 6,887 mi.
- To reach Bondoukou in this distance one would set out from Kawthaung bearing 280°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Bondoukou bearing 258.4° or WSW .
- Bondoukou has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Kawthaung has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Bondoukou is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Kawthaung is in or near the subtropical wet for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 0.8 °C (1.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.3 °C (2.3°F) more in Bondoukou.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2856.1 mm (112.4 in) less which is equivalent to 2856.1 l/m² (70.1 US gal/ft²) or 28,561,000 l/ha (3,053,360 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.4° higher in Bondoukou than in Kawthaung.
